Investing in real estate is one of the great tax shelters available to persons, especially in high tax brackets. What is a tax shelter? Basically, it’s an investment that allows you to keep some money that you’ve earned, rather than give it to Uncle Sam in the form of income taxes.

Real Estate investors of income property are allowed a depreciation allowance which has the same affect on your income tax as exemptions for your dependents. It comes right off the top.
